Eric S. Raymond is a prominent figure in the hacker community, known for his anthropological study of Internet hacker culture.
His research has significantly contributed to understanding the open-source software development model, which has been crucial in shaping the Internet's evolution.
Raymond is a multifaceted individual, combining his technological expertise with diverse interests.
He is a science fiction enthusiast, musician, and martial artist with a Black Belt in Tae Kwon Do.
Additionally, he is an activist advocating for First and Second Amendment rights.
Raymond's work has been instrumental in explaining and promoting the decentralized approach to software development that has become increasingly prevalent in the tech industry.
